I had the great fortune of finding a custom Digital Designs sub on craigslist for a great price. It has an additional motor attached to the back of a DD diaphram. The surround and dust cap were upgraded as well. The previous owner was running 10k watts to this beast. I also have two JuiceBox banana AGM batteries (110AH each).

I am curious for some advice about how to deal with such a powerful sub. I know it's not going to be a great SQ sub, but I am not trying to build a one-note wonder for competing with. I just want to see what it takes to install an extreme speaker like this.

Things I know I need to do:

  • Big 3 with 0 AWG, all copper
  • Need to get another AWG battery for the engine compartment
  • 0 AWG from engine compartment back to trunk
  • Battery isolator between two batteries
  • Use bars to attach batteries together in the back
  • Use dual 0 AWG cables for the sub amp's positive and negative poles
  • Dynamat the entire inside of the car to control resonances
  • Strengthen the sub enclosure with cross-braces
  • The sub is so long, that when mounted horizontally, the back of the magnet will need to be held in place by some sort of mdf "craddle".
  • Remote sub control to leave the bass at musical levels most of the time
  • Run a 1 ohm amp to power it (4 total voice coils configured down to 1 ohm)
  • My windows can break running this sub


Things I am unsure of:

  • Is there any reason not to run the Lanzar Opt110001D? (the price tag is very appealing)
  • Should the amp be grounded to the chasis AND the negative terminals on the batteries in back? (this makes more sense than only grounding to the chassis)
  • Do I need a third JuiceBox banana in order to run 10k to this speaker?
  • Will I need to build a double baffle enclosure for this sub?
  • What can I do to strengthen my windows without spending thousands on special windows for car audio?


What am I missing here? How can I get the most out of this speaker without exploding my car (literally)?
